Renting vs Purchasing
When it comes to enhancing security at your construction site or event, one of the main decisions to make is whether to rent or purchase a surveillance trailer. Both options have their own set of pros and cons, and it's important to carefully weigh them before making a decision. Renting a surveillance trailer can be a cost-effective solution, as it eliminates the need for a large upfront investment. Additionally, if you only need the trailer for a short period of time, renting may be a more practical option. On the other hand, purchasing a surveillance trailer gives you the freedom and flexibility to use it whenever and wherever you need it.You also have the option to customize the trailer to fit your specific security needs. However, purchasing a surveillance trailer can be quite expensive and may not be a feasible option for every budget. It also requires ongoing maintenance and storage costs. Ultimately, the decision between renting or purchasing a surveillance trailer will depend on your specific security needs and budget. Consider carefully weighing the pros and cons of each option before making a decision.
Wireless Security Cameras
When it comes to securing a construction site or event, wireless security cameras are a popular and cost-effective alternative to purchasing a surveillance trailer. Not only are they more affordable, but they also offer a variety of features and functionality that can rival that of a traditional surveillance trailer. One of the main advantages of using wireless security cameras is the ability to access live footage remotely.This means that you can monitor your construction site or event from anywhere, at any time. This is especially useful for larger construction sites or events that may require constant monitoring. Additionally, many wireless security cameras come with motion detection and alerts, allowing you to be notified instantly if there is any suspicious activity. Another factor to consider when comparing costs is the installation process. Purchasing and installing a surveillance trailer can be time-consuming and expensive.
With wireless security cameras, however, the installation process is much simpler and can be done by anyone with basic knowledge of technology. This not only saves time and money, but also allows for more flexibility in terms of placement and coverage. Functionality-wise, wireless security cameras offer a wide range of features such as night vision, high-definition video quality, and weatherproofing. These features make them suitable for both indoor and outdoor use, providing 24/7 surveillance regardless of the conditions. Some models even offer pan, tilt, and zoom capabilities, giving you full control over the camera's view. In conclusion, when comparing costs and functionality, wireless security cameras are a practical and cost-effective alternative to purchasing a surveillance trailer for construction sites or events.
With their remote access, easy installation, and advanced features, they provide the same level of security without the high price tag. Consider incorporating wireless security cameras into your construction site or event security plan for a more budget-friendly and efficient solution.
Mobile Security Camera Systems
When it comes to securing a construction site or event, a surveillance trailer may seem like the obvious choice. One such alternative is the use of mobile security camera systems. Mobile security camera systems are compact, portable, and versatile. They can be easily installed and moved around the construction site as needed.This allows for maximum coverage and monitoring of all areas, without the need for a permanent surveillance trailer. These systems also come equipped with advanced features such as motion detection, night vision, and high-definition video recording. This means that you can have round-the-clock surveillance of your construction site or event, even in low light conditions. Another advantage of using mobile security camera systems is their cost-effectiveness. Compared to purchasing and maintaining a surveillance trailer, these systems are much more affordable.
They also do not require any additional equipment or personnel to operate, saving you even more money. In addition to being cost-effective, mobile security camera systems are also highly customizable. You can choose the number of cameras and their placement based on your specific needs and the layout of your construction site or event. This allows for a tailored security solution that best fits your requirements. In conclusion, when it comes to enhancing security at your construction site or event, mobile security camera systems are a highly effective and practical alternative to purchasing a surveillance trailer. They offer advanced features, affordability, and customization options that make them a valuable asset in keeping your site safe and secure.
